Evaluation of post retention using different cementing techniques
Objectives: The objective of this study was to evaluate in vitro the retention of intraradicular posts varying the application technique of the adhesive and resin cement in the prosthetic space. The crowns of sixty endodontically treated maxillary canines were discarded and the roots included in acrylic resin. Methods: The prosthetic spaces were prepared with a largo bur activated with a micromotor attached to a parallelometer in order to maintain the length and diameter of the intraradicular posts constant. After casting, the posts were randomly divided into 3 groups according to the application technique of the cement: G1 with a post, G2 with a lentulo bur and in G3 the association of both. Each group was then divided into 3 subgroups according to the application technique of the adhesive: with a microbrush or with a brush. Seventy-two h after cementing, the posts were tractioned at a velocity of 1 mm/min by a universal testing machine (Instron 4444). Results: There was a statistically significant difference (p<0.01) between application techniques of the adhesive. However, regarding the application technique of the cement in the interior of the root canal, the cement placed with the post was statistically different from the other two methods (p<0.01). Conclusions: We conclude that the application techniques of the adhesive with the microbrush had the best results and that the cement placed into the prosthetic space before the placement of the post favored its retention.
